1.5SMC SERIES
1500 Watts Surface Mount Transient Voltage Suppressor
SMC/DO-214AB
Features
For surface mounted application in order to optimize
board space
Low profile package
Built-in strain relief
Glass passivated junction
Excellent clamping capability
Fast response time: Typically less than 1.0ps from 0
volt to BV min.

Mechanical Data
Case: Molded plastic
Terminals: Solder plated
Polarity: Indicated by cathode band
Weight: 0.21gram
